style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">Ruling on delta protects fish,
jeopardizes <st1:place w:st="on"><st1:State
w:st="on">California</st1:State></st1:place> water
deliveries<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></SPAN></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><SPAN class=headline11><B><FONT face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">Associated Press –
3/23/07<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></SPAN></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><SPAN class=headline11><B><FONT face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">By Samantha Young, staff
writer</SPAN></FONT></B></SPAN><SPAN class=headline11><B><FONT
face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: normal;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></SPAN></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><st1:place w:st="on"><st1:City w:st="on"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">SACRAMENTO</SPAN></FONT></st1:City></st1:place><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"> -- In a
decision that could cripple state water deliveries, a judge has ordered the
state to halt pumping water out of the delta within 60 days unless it complies
with environmental laws that protect endangered fish.<BR><BR>The ruling pleased
sport fishing groups that have long criticized the state's operation of the
enormous pumps, which suck in and kill salmon and other
fish.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"It's
certainly an earthshaking decision," Bill Jennings, executive director of the
California Sportfishing Protection Alliance, said Friday. His group had sued the
state.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<TABLE class=MsoNormalTable cellSpacing=0 cellPadding=0 align=right border=0>
<TBODY>
<TR>
<TD
style="PADDING-RIGHT: 0pt; PADDING-LEFT: 0pt; PADDING-BOTTOM: 0pt; PADDING-TOP: 0pt">
<P class=MsoNormal style="mso-element: frame"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P></TD></TR></TBODY></TABLE>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Thursday's
ruling by Alameda County Superior Court Judge Frank Roesch found that the state
Department of Water Resources lacks the proper permits to run a key station that
pumps water from the delta into the California Aqueduct.<BR><BR>Specifically,
Roesch said the water agency should apply for permits that would allow it to
kill spring and winter runs of salmon and Delta smelt, which are protected under
the California Endangered Species Act.<BR><BR>At issue is the Harvey O. Banks
Pumping Plant west of <st1:City w:st="on"><st1:place
w:st="on">Stockton</st1:place></st1:City>, which funnels 10,688 cubic feet per
second of delta water through 11 pumps into the 444-mile long aqueduct. The
heart of the State Water Project, the pumping station sucks in and kills
significant quantities of fish.<BR><BR>Water for more than 23 million
Californians and 750,000 acres of farmland passes through the Sacramento-San
Joaquin Delta.<BR><BR>The decision also has implications for federal water
deliveries in the <st1:place w:st="on">Central Valley</st1:place>. About 5
percent of water that is part of the federal Central Valley Project flows
through the Banks pumping station.<BR><BR>"There is a coordinated operation
between the two projects. We'll have to analyze the indirect effects," said
Thomas Birmingham, general manager of the Westlands Water District, which
supplies water to about 600,000 acres of farmland in western <st1:City
w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on">Fresno</st1:place></st1:City> and Kings
counties.<BR><BR>The Department of Water Resources had argued in court that its
pumping operations were authorized by a series of agreements struck over the
past 20 years and by a 1997 state law.<BR><BR>In his 34-page ruling, Roesch said
those agreements "do not qualify as the carte-blanche authorization of
incidental take" at the plant for all species of endangered
fish.<BR><BR>Department of Water Resources spokesman Ted Thomas said the state
is expected to appeal the ruling. If that happens, pumping would continue while
the ruling is being challenged, according to the order.<BR><BR>Meanwhile, the
spotlight will shift to the California Department of Fish and Game. Under the
judge's ruling, the department would have to approve environmental permits for
the state to operate the pumps.<BR><BR>Those permits would require the state to
minimize fish kills and could lead to a change in how much water is sent through
the pumps and when much of the pumping would occur.<BR><BR>Environmentalists
have argued that the Department of Water Resources pumps too heavily during the
winter months. They say that has led to declining populations of the Delta smelt
because female fish that are sucked into the pumps die before their eggs are
fertilized.<BR><BR>The smelt, which average 3 inches long, are considered a key
indicator of the health of the Sacramento-San Joaquin Delta.<BR><BR>"This tale
is only beginning," said <st1:City w:st="on"><st1:place
w:st="on">Jennings</st1:place></st1:City>, of the sportfishing alliance.
#<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>

<P class=MsoNormal><B><FONT face=Tahoma color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">Deadline
set on permits for delta pumping; </SPAN></FONT></B><B><FONT face=Tahoma
color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">Judge
threatens a halt unless the state gets permission to kill endangered fish.
Officials cite the economic effect of a
shutdown<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><st1:City w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on"><B><FONT face=Tahoma
color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">Los
Angeles</SPAN></FONT></B></st1:place></st1:City><B><FONT face=Tahoma color=black
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">
Times – 3/24/07<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><B><FONT face=Tahoma color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">By
Bettina Boxall, staff writer</SPAN></FONT></B><FONT face="Times New Roman"
color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">A Superior Court judge
has given the state two months to get environmental permits in the
Sacramento-San Joaquin Delta or he will shut down the massive <st1:place
w:st="on">Northern California</st1:place> pumps that kill endangered fish in the
process of supplying the Southland with much of its water.<BR><BR>State
officials vowed to fight the ruling, predicting dire consequences for the
<st1:State w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on">California</st1:place></st1:State>
economy if the pumping stopped.<BR><BR>"It would be unacceptable to curtail all
deliveries to the State Water Project," said Department of Water Resources
Director Lester Snow, adding that the project supports a $300-billion share of
the state's economy.<BR><BR>"That's a lot of farm jobs, industrial jobs and
homes."<BR><BR>The delta supplies 60% of the water distributed by the
Metropolitan Water District of Southern California, the region's major water
wholesaler.<BR><BR>Although the state will almost certainly find a way to keep
the pumps operating at some level, Thursday's ruling by Alameda County Superior
Court Judge Frank Roesch could force reductions in the flow of water to the
south.<BR><BR>It is also likely to move the state another step closer to
dramatically overhauling the way it manages water shipments between Northern and
<st1:place w:st="on">Southern California</st1:place>. <BR><BR>"There are
obviously things that are going to have to be done," said Bill Jennings,
executive director of the California Sportfishing Protection Alliance, which
filed the environmental lawsuit in which the judge ruled. "It's no longer
business as usual."<BR><BR>The judge agreed with the argument by <st1:City
w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on">Jennings</st1:place></st1:City>' group that the
Department of Water Resources has never gotten the necessary authorization from
the California Department of Fish and Game to kill threatened and endangered
fish at the delta's Harvey O. Banks pumping operation. The operation forms the
heart of the State Water Project that supplies urban <st1:place
w:st="on">Southern California</st1:place>.<BR><BR>The decision comes at a time
of escalating concern over the fate of the delta east of <st1:City
w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on">San Francisco</st1:place></st1:City> and its
rapidly declining fish populations. <BR><BR>The tiny, native delta smelt has
sunk to record lows during the last three years, and introduced species and
native salmon are also struggling.<BR><BR>Research suggests that the pumping
operation is a leading cause of the decline in fish, if by no means the only
cause.<BR><BR>Despite an elaborate, expensive screening process, fish die at the
pumps. To keep salty <st1:place w:st="on"><st1:PlaceName w:st="on">San
Francisco</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Type
w:st="on">Bay</st1:PlaceType></st1:place> water away from the pumps, the project
has altered the delta's natural salinity levels. The pumps are so powerful that
they can reverse the flow of water in the channels that crisscross the
delta.<BR><BR>Changes in the pumping regimen intended to protect spawning fish
appear simply to have shifted mortality — killing smelt before they can spawn,
or killing the young.<BR><BR>Though the judge's warning does not signal an
immediate crisis for water managers, they are taking it seriously.<BR><BR>"We
see this as a strong signal by the judge," said Jeffrey Kightlinger, the water
district's general manager.<BR><BR>The court order, he said, is another sign
that "transporting water through the delta is simply not sustainable in the long
run."<BR><BR>Kightlinger said the water district could tap a large reserve if
the pumping is stopped and would not have to resort to immediate
rationing.<BR><BR>But, he said, "We'd hate to use that up."<BR><BR>Kightlinger
added, "We will be working with the state very hard to try and make sure they do
not shut the pumps." <BR><BR>The judge's ruling is the latest development in
more than a decade of environmental fights and government programs to fix the
troubled delta, a sprawling area that is <st1:State w:st="on"><st1:place
w:st="on">California</st1:place></st1:State>'s water crossroads.<BR><BR>"This is
a very important event. It really is," Barry Nelson of the Natural Resources
Defense Council said, calling the opinion a landmark.<BR><BR>State officials
learned of the decision Friday and in a hastily called news conference said they
would ask the judge to give them more time to meet his demands.<BR><BR>They also
disputed the judge's finding that they had never obtained the proper
authorizations to kill fish under the state Endangered Species Act.
#<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>

<P class=MsoNormal><st1:PlaceName w:st="on"><B><FONT face=Tahoma color=black
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">JUDGE</SPAN></FONT></B></st1:PlaceName><B><FONT
face=Tahoma color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">
<st1:PlaceName w:st="on">ORDERS</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Type
w:st="on">STATE</st1:PlaceType>: STOP KILLING DELTA FISH;
</SPAN></FONT></B><B><FONT face=Tahoma color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">Agency
told to obey law in 60 days or shut down pumps that send water to <st1:place
w:st="on">Southern California</st1:place><o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><B><FONT face=Tahoma color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">San
Francisco Chronicle – 3/24/07<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><B><FONT face=Tahoma color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">By
Glen Martin, staff writer</SPAN></FONT></B><FONT face="Times New Roman"
color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The pumps
that send water to 24 million Californians illegally kill endangered and
threatened fish species and must be shut down, an <st1:place
w:st="on"><st1:PlaceName w:st="on">Alameda</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Type
w:st="on">County</st1:PlaceType></st1:place> judge has decided.
<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The
judge's draft decision, released Friday, is far-reaching in scope, but nobody
expects immediate rationing in the areas that receive the water -- the
<st1:PlaceName w:st="on">East</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Type
w:st="on">Bay</st1:PlaceType>, the <st1:PlaceName
w:st="on">South</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Type w:st="on">Bay</st1:PlaceType> and
<st1:place w:st="on">Southern California</st1:place>. Judge Frank Roesch gave
the state 60 days to figure out a way to comply with the law.
<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Ultimately,
the state Department of Water Resources could be forced to radically change the
way it allocates water via a complicated set of canals and reservoirs known as
the State Water Project. Changes could mean more water for the beleaguered
Sacramento-San Joaquin River Delta and less for municipalities and <st1:place
w:st="on">Central Valley</st1:place> farms.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The
decision further undercuts the faltering consensus approach that has guided
state water politics during the past decade, and it harks back to the 1970s and
1980s, when acrimony and litigation prevailed.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Consequences
of changing State Water Project operations are huge: The system is a major
source of water for cities like <st1:place w:st="on"><st1:City w:st="on">Los
Angeles</st1:City></st1:place> and irrigates 775,000 acres of cropland. State
officials say it is also directly responsible for a $300 billion portion of the
<st1:place w:st="on"><st1:State w:st="on">California</st1:State></st1:place>
economy.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">At a
minimum, complying with the judge's decision will force the state water agency
to obtain a permit from the California Department of Fish and Game allowing the
"incidental" killing of delta smelt and chinook salmon at the Harvey O. Banks
Pumping Plant near Tracy as well as to develop a plan to aid in the recovery of
the protected fish.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Roesch's
ruling was in response to a 2006 lawsuit over the killing of the fish. The suit
was filed by the California Sportfishing Protection Alliance against the
California Resources Agency, which oversees the Department of Water Resources
and the State Water Project.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Officials
have two weeks to provide more information, after which Roesch can either modify
or maintain his order.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"This was
a bell ringer," said Bill Jennings, the executive director of the <st1:City
w:st="on">Alliance</st1:City>, a confederation of anglers based in <st1:place
w:st="on"><st1:City w:st="on">Stockton</st1:City></st1:place>.
<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"We have a
real likelihood now that the delta will receive more water," he said.
<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><st1:City w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Jennings</SPAN></FONT></st1:place></st1:City><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"> said that
the Water Resources Department ignored the California Endangered Species Act and
state Fish and Game codes in operating its pumps, which have ground up large
numbers of fish.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The
state's pumping station can transport 10,300 cubic feet of water a second,
equivalent to a large river. The nearby pumps that sustain the federal Central
Valley Project are much smaller, with a capacity of about 4,600 cfs. The Central
Valley Project is not affected by Roesch's decision.
<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The Water
Resources Department maintained it was given a pass on state laws by virtue of
five agreements concluded in the 1990s, including two negotiated by CalFed, the
joint state and federal agency created to solve <st1:place w:st="on"><st1:State
w:st="on">California</st1:State></st1:place>'s water disputes.
<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Roesch
ruled that the agreements did not constitute a permit to kill the salmon and
smelt, as the state contended.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The best
that can be said of the five agreements, Roesch wrote, "is that (they) accept
fish will be killed in the Henry O. Banks Pumping Plant operations and that the
parties agree that mitigation measures will be undertaken."
<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">State
officials expressed dismay at the decision.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"We
obviously strongly disagree with the court's proposed decision and will present
additional information to challenge (it)," state Resources Secretary Mike
Chrisman said.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Ryan
Broddrick, the director of the California Department of Fish and Game, said
conservation strategies of the kind Roesch requires are complicated and
time-consuming.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"We want
to find solutions for the delta that have long-term sustainability," Broddrick
said. "The (60-day) time frame offered is not sufficient."
<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Lester
Snow, the director of the Water Resources Department and the former director of
CalFed, agreed with Broddrick and noted that the state recently authorized a $1
billion delta habitat conservation plan. Such a comprehensive and well-funded
effort, Snow said, is preferable to fighting the matter out in court.
<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"(Roesch's)
response is devoid of any recognition of this conservation plan," he said.
<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Snow also
said that the consequences of curtailing <st1:place w:st="on">Southern
California</st1:place> water deliveries would be unacceptable.
<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"The
<st1:place w:st="on"><st1:State w:st="on">California</st1:State></st1:place>
gross product is $1.6 trillion," he said. "Of that, the State Water Project
directly supports $300 billion. That's a lot of farm and industrial jobs."
<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Water
contractors also are concerned.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"We get 80
percent of our water from the state project, so we find this very worrisome,"
said Jill Duerig, the general manager of the Zone 7 Water Agency, which serves
the <st1:PlaceName w:st="on">East</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Type
w:st="on">Bay</st1:PlaceType> cities of <st1:City
w:st="on">Pleasanton</st1:City>, <st1:City w:st="on">Dublin</st1:City> and
<st1:City w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on">Livermore</st1:place></st1:City>.
<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"It
highlights the uncertainty and risks we face in securing our drinking water
supplies," she said.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">But
<st1:City w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on">Jennings</st1:place></st1:City> said
Roesch's decision "blew away the smoke screen" that obscured many delta problems
and underscored the general failure of CalFed.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"Under
CalFed, water exports from the delta have increased, and we've seen the general
collapse of the region's ecosystem," he said. "It became clear to anglers that
if we were going to have any fish left in the delta, we were going to have to
step away from the backroom deals and hold the agencies accountable to the law."
<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>

<P class=MsoNormal><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Declining
delta smelt <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">A small
native fish long used as an indicator of the delta's biological health, the
delta smelt has sustained steady declines over the past several years. Fresh
water diversions from the delta to <st1:place w:st="on">Southern
California</st1:place> appear to be the leading cause, with smelt populations
declining in general proportion to the amount of water shipped south.
<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Smelt need
brackish water to survive, and the brackish zone in the delta is decreased when
fresh water is exported. The government pumps have also been implicated in
directly destroying smelt by sucking them into their intakes.
<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Breeding
season: </SPAN></FONT></B><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">From late
winter to early summer. Fast growing, with majority of growth within the first 7
to 9 months of life.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Food:</SPAN></FONT></B><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"> Small
organisms called zooplankton Life span: 1-2 years <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Status:</SPAN></FONT></B><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">
Threatened <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Size:</SPAN></FONT></B><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"> 2-3
inches, but can reach 5 inches <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Habitat:</SPAN></FONT></B><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"> Brackish
waters in the Sacramento-San Joaquin River Delta <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>

<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><B><FONT
face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">Water agency put
on notice<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><B><FONT
face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">Contra Costa
Times – 3/24/07<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><B><FONT
face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">By Mike Taugher,
staff writer</SPAN></FONT></B><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The state's
largest water delivery system, serving millions of people from the Tri-Valley to
<st1:place w:st="on">Southern California</st1:place>, must shut down in 60 days
unless its officials comply with the state's endangered species law, a judge
ruled.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The
decision, which sent shock waves through water agencies up and down <st1:State
w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on">California</st1:place></st1:State> on Friday,
says state water officials failed to obtain a state permit to kill threatened or
endangered salmon and Delta smelt.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Alameda
County Superior Court Judge Frank Roesch ruled that the Department of Water
Resources was violating the California Endangered Species Act but said he would
delay turning off the pumps for 60 days to allow state agencies to comply. The
ruling also said the 60-day clock will not start ticking until it becomes final
after a 15-day comment period.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">State
officials said they would ask the judge to reconsider, arguing that they are
trying to develop a long-term conservation strategy, and shutting off the pumps
would deal a devastating economic blow.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"I don't
think it's possible to comply with what the judge says in 60 days," said water
Resources director Lester Snow.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Most major
water agencies have sufficient backup supplies to get them through a short
pumping shutdown. However, if the permit required by the court's decision
further restricts pumping, it could reduce the amount of water those agencies
get in the long term.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">At issue
are massive pumps that supply water to more than 23 million people in
<st1:PlaceName w:st="on">Alameda</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Type
w:st="on">County</st1:PlaceType>, Silicon Valley and <st1:place
w:st="on">Southern California</st1:place>. The pumps are powerful enough to
alter the flow of rivers, disrupt fish movements and kill millions of fish each
year.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Among those
fish are species such as Delta smelt, winter-run salmon and spring-run salmon
that are protected under state and federal endangered species laws. The pumping
plant has a permit from the federal government to harm endangered fish, but not
from the state.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Environmentalists say a
state permit might force water supply cuts because the state law is more
stringent than the federal law.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The ruling
does not affect smaller federal pumps that serve <st1:place
w:st="on"><st1:PlaceName w:st="on">San Joaquin</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Type
w:st="on">Valley</st1:PlaceType></st1:place> farms.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Stan
Williams, chief executive officer of the Santa Clara Valley Water District, said
groundwater and access to <st1:place w:st="on"><st1:City w:st="on">San
Francisco</st1:City></st1:place>'s Hetch Hetchy aqueducts would provide
short-term backup water supplies but a prolonged shutdown could cause
problems.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">He added
that he views the threat of a shutdown as
plausible.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"I think
it's real," Williams said.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The general
manager of the Metropolitan Water District of Southern California, the state
water pumps' biggest customer, said he was disappointed in the ruling but added
that emergency water reserves can meet the summer needs of its 18 million
customers.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"What we
need from Fish and Game is their best analysis of what they can do in 60 days
and then see if that will satisfy the court," said Met general manager Jeff
Kightlinger. "We're working rapidly on our contingency
planning."<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Environmentalists,
meanwhile, were elated.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"It's a
mind-buster. I'm stunned," said Bill Jennings, executive director of the
California Sportfishing Protection Alliance, which filed the lawsuit last
year.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The ruling
comes at a time of deepening disarray in <st1:place w:st="on"><st1:State
w:st="on">California</st1:State></st1:place> water policy. The state's major
water source -- the Delta -- is laboring five years into an ecosystem collapse
that many scientists say is at least partly due to the water
pumps.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The failure
of state water officials to obtain a permit for the pumps was uncovered in 2005
by a state senate committee.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">That
committee's investigation was in response to a report in the Times showing that
in early 2005, just as the severity of the Delta's ecosystem crisis was becoming
apparent, state and federal water officials twice overruled the advice of
biologists appointed to enforce the federal endangered species
law.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">State water
officials argued that even though they lacked a formal permit, a series of
agreements and other documents dating back to the 1980s formed a "patchwork" of
compliance with the law.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The judge
strongly disagreed, saying the documents "do not qualify as carte-blanche
authorization" to kill or harm endangered fish.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Michael
Lozeau, the lawyer who represented environmentalists in the lawsuit, said the
state endangered species law is stricter than the federal
version.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Under state
law, the water resources department would have to offset the death of every
protected fish, possibly by dramatically reducing pumping or improving habitat
elsewhere in the Delta, Lozeau said.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"They have
to replace every single fish," Lozeau said.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><st1:place w:st="on"><st1:City
w:st="on"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Jennings</SPAN></FONT></st1:City></st1:place><FONT
face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"> said that opens the
door to force the state water department to make up for years of illegal
operations.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al style="BACKGROUND: white"><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"When you
catch the embezzler, what do you do? You make them pay it back," <st1:City
w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on">Jennings</st1:place></st1:City> said.
#<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>

<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><B><FONT
face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">Pump ruling may
cut water to south state<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><st1:City
w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on"><B><FONT face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">Sacramento</SPAN></FONT></B></st1:place></st1:City><B><FONT
face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ma"> Bee –
3/24/07<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><B><FONT
face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">By Deb Kollars,
staff writer</SPAN></FONT></B><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=#053c63 size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: #053c63;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">An Alameda Superior Court judge has ruled that giant
pumps sending vast amounts of drinking water to Central and Southern California
must be turned off within 60 days unless the state complies with permit
procedures designed to protect endangered fish, which are getting chewed up by
the pumps.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">Turning off the pumps in the Sacramento-San Joaquin
Delta would cause drastic economic and environmental consequences, ranging from
possible groundwater depletion to business interruptions, said Lester Snow,
director of the state Department of Water
Resources.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">"It's certainly an earth-shaking decision," said Bill
Jennings, executive director of the nonprofit California Sportfishing Protection
Alliance, which sued the state over the killing of fish in the
pumps.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">About 25 million Californians depend on the State Water
Project, as the north-south water-moving system is called, for at least a
portion of their water needs.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">The Metropolitan Water District of Southern California,
for example, is the state project's biggest customer, serving 18 million people;
during normal water years, the district gets 16 percent of its overall water
supply via the gigantic state delivery system.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">Snow said Friday that he plans to bring new information
to the judge in the case, Frank Roesch, and ask him to reconsider the ruling
during the 15-day period before the decision becomes
final.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">"We strongly disagree with the decision," California
Resources Secretary Mike Chrisman said during a Friday afternoon telephone press
briefing.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">The Department of Water Resources was sued in October by
the "Water Enforcers," the legal arm of the California Sportfishing Protection
Alliance. The fishing group said the agency never obtained the proper
authorizations, known as "take permits," to kill certain fish while pumping
water from the north state to the Bay Area, Central Coast, San Joaquin Valley
and Southern California.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">The suit named three fish species: the endangered
winter-run chinook salmon, the threatened spring-run chinook and the Delta
smelt.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">The pumping site in the case, Harvey O. Banks Pumping
Plant, is west of <st1:place w:st="on"><st1:City
w:st="on">Stockton</st1:City></st1:place> near Byron. The plant, considered the
heart of the State Water Project, runs 10,688 cubic feet per second of Delta
water through multiple pumps and into the California Aqueduct system. In the
process, many fish are sucked in and killed.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">On Thursday, Roesch agreed with the fishing group,
ruling that DWR had failed to follow the permitting process required under the
California Endangered Species Act. The permits are issued by the state
Department of Fish and Game.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">The judge rejected an argument by DWR officials that
they did not need the formal take permits because the department had authority
to kill fish during water exports under several other pumping agreements made
prior to 1997.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">The agreements, the judge wrote in his ruling, "do not
qualify as the carte-blanche authorization of incidental take" of endangered
fish at the pumping plant.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">Water resources officials reviewed the judge's opinion
Friday and announced they will ask the judge to reconsider. Department spokesman
Ted Thomas said the state is expected to appeal the
ruling.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><st1:City w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">Jennings</SPAN></FONT></st1:place></st1:City><FONT
size=4><SPAN lang=EN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"> said there is an easier fix for
the state than trying to re-argue the case before the same judge or appealing:
Apply for the proper permits, which would lay out the measures needed, such as
reducing pumping volumes or installing different fish screens, to reduce the
fish kills.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">"The political reality is that nobody is going to
deprive the folks of Southern California their water," <st1:place
w:st="on"><st1:City w:st="on">Jennings</st1:City></st1:place> said. "It would
behoove the state to start working on a permit and following the
law."<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">Snow said it would not be possible to get such a permit
within 60 days.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><st1:place w:st="on"><st1:City w:st="on"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">Jennings</SPAN></FONT></st1:City></st1:place><FONT
size=4><SPAN lang=EN style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"> pointed out that the state would
have 75 days if it got going immediately, before the 15-day grace period on the
judge's ruling runs out, and that would be plenty of
time.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">"We have gone through a decade where the state has
basically done nothing," <st1:place w:st="on"><st1:City
w:st="on">Jennings</st1:City></st1:place> said. "They twiddled their thumbs and
gazed at the ceiling."<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">Snow said that rather than going through the narrow
permitting process, the state instead has chosen to develop a broad new
conservation plan for the Delta that would address numerous habitat and
environmental issues in a more comprehensive
manner.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">This week's ruling, he said, highlights the dire
situation in the Delta, where environmentalists and state and local officials
are grappling with everything from crumbling levees to rapid losses in the Delta
smelt population.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P style="MARGIN: 0pt"><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N lang=EN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">Neither side could say Friday how many salmon are being
killed in the pumps. #<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>

<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><B><FONT
face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">State has 60
days to get permits or stop pumps<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><st1:City
w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on"><B><FONT face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">Stockton</SPAN></FONT></B></st1:place></st1:City><B><FONT
face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ma"> Record –
3/24/07<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><B><FONT
face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">By Alex
Breitler, staff writer</SPAN></FONT></B><FONT face="Times New Roman"
color=#053c63 size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: #053c63;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=#053c63 size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: #053c63;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><st1:place w:st="on"><st1:City w:st="on"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">TRACY</SPAN></FONT></st1:City></st1:place><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"> - State
officials have 60 days to avert a legally imposed shutdown of their massive
export pumps, which kill threatened fish but also support a $300 billion
economy.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">A judge's
ruling released Friday says the Department of Water Resources has been
incidentally killing fish at the pumps without proper environmental permits, in
violation of state law.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The state
must shut down the pumps near <st1:City w:st="on"><st1:place
w:st="on">Tracy</st1:place></st1:City> if it cannot get the needed permits in
time.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"Potentially,
this is a huge victory," said <st1:place w:st="on"><st1:City
w:st="on">Stockton</st1:City></st1:place> environmentalist Bill Jennings, whose
California Sportfishing Protection Alliance sued the state last year. "This is
just the opening chapter of a new book."<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">State
officials Friday afternoon said there's no way to get the needed permits in 60
days.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"We're
perplexed with the court's ruling in this case," said Lester Snow, head of the
Department of Water Resources. "We find the prospect of curtailment of pumping
to be unacceptable."<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Snow said
the state has 15 days to comment on the ruling by Alameda County Superior Court
Judge Frank Roesch and ask for more time to comply.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">A shutdown
of the pumps is unlikely, <st1:place w:st="on"><st1:City
w:st="on">Jennings</st1:City></st1:place> said. However, getting a permit under
state law to kill fish such as Delta smelt and salmon would require officials to
find new ways to make up for that loss. That could include reducing exports or
changing the timing of water deliveries to aid
fish.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">State Sen.
Michael Machado, D-Linden, said it was no mystery to <st1:place
w:st="on"><st1:PlaceName w:st="on">San Joaquin</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Type
w:st="on">County</st1:PlaceType></st1:place> residents that the pumps are
operated without the proper permits. State officials have claimed that a series
of agreements up to two decades old were tantamount to having such a
permit.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"What this
goes to show is that the ecosystem of the Delta is important and the state needs
to follow its own laws," Machado said Friday.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">No one
disputes that the pumps are important. Eighteen million people in Southern
California receive water imported from two major sources: the Colorado River and
<st1:place w:st="on">Northern
California</st1:place>.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Drought on
the <st1:State w:st="on">Colorado</st1:State> has increased reliance on the
<st1:place w:st="on">Northern California</st1:place> flows, said Jeff
Kightlinger, general manager of the Metropolitan Water District of Southern
California.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"This is a
very serious issue," he said Friday. "We're hopeful we can work with the state
to get it resolved over the next 60 days and not go through dramatic
interruptions."<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The
district has "tremendous" amounts of water in storage, but that's reserved for
emergencies and could last only a year or two, Kightlinger
said.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">State
water is also delivered to the Bay Area, cities and farms in the southern
<st1:PlaceName w:st="on">San Joaquin</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Type
w:st="on">Valley</st1:PlaceType> and parts of the coast near <st1:City
w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on">San Luis
Obispo</st1:place></st1:City>.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Altogether,
the pumps support $300 billion of the state's $1.6 trillion economy, said the
state's Snow.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The pumps
also draw in threatened Delta smelt, which conservationists say are on the brink
of extinction. They also harm juvenile salmon.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"They have
to come up with near-term and long-term measures" to protect fish, <st1:place
w:st="on"><st1:City w:st="on">Jennings</st1:City></st1:place> said. "And we're
going to be looking over their shoulder." #<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>

<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><B><FONT
face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ma; LETTER-SPACING: -0.65pt">Water
decision a blow to Kern farming<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><st1:City
w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on"><B><FONT face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ma; LETTER-SPACING: -0.65pt">Bakersfield</SPAN></FONT></B></st1:place></st1:City><B><FONT
face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ma; LETTER-SPACING: -0.65pt">
Californian – 3/23/07<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><B><FONT
face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ma; LETTER-SPACING: -0.65pt">By
Vic Pollard, staff writer</SPAN></FONT></B><FONT face="Times New Roman"
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'; LETTER-SPACING: -0.65pt"><o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=#053c63 size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: #053c63;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Like other customers of
the State Water Project, Kern County Water Agency officials were stunned by the
judge’s action. “This is big,” said David Baumstark, the agency’s executive
operations manager.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">He said late Friday
afternoon the agency had little time to review the proposed decision and had no
plan of action yet.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">However, a sudden
shutdown in May of the California Aqueduct, which brings state project water to
<st1:PlaceName w:st="on">Kern</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Type
w:st="on">County</st1:PlaceType>, would be a major financial blow to the
<st1:place w:st="on"><st1:PlaceName w:st="on">Kern</st1:PlaceName>
<st1:PlaceType w:st="on">County</st1:PlaceType></st1:place> farming industry at
the height of the irrigation season.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">It wouldn’t be the end
of the world, Baumstark said, because <st1:PlaceName
w:st="on">Kern</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Type w:st="on">County</st1:PlaceType>
has huge amounts of water stored underground in the Kern Water Bank area west of
<st1:City w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on">Bakersfield</st1:place></st1:City> and
other places.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">But groundwater is more
expensive to use for irrigation than water from the aqueduct because of the
costs of pumping it out of the ground.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Baumstark said the State
Water Project accounts for about 21 percent of all the water used in <st1:place
w:st="on"><st1:PlaceName w:st="on">Kern</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Type
w:st="on">County</st1:PlaceType></st1:place>. The other major sources are the
Kern River; the Central Valley Project, which brings water from the
<st1:PlaceName w:st="on">San Joaquin</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Type
w:st="on">River</st1:PlaceType> near <st1:City w:st="on"><st1:place
w:st="on">Fresno</st1:place></st1:City>; and groundwater.
#<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>

<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><B><FONT
face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">Future of Delta
smelt may carry consequences<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><st1:City
w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on"><B><FONT face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">Stockton</SPAN></FONT></B></st1:place></st1:City><B><FONT
face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ma"> Record –
3/25/07<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><B><FONT
face=Tahoma size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; FONT-FAMILY: Tahoma">By Alex
Breitler, staff writer</SPAN></FONT></B><FONT face="Times New Roman"
color=#053c63 size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: #053c63;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><st1:place
w:st="on"><st1:City w:st="on"><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=black
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">TRACY</SPAN></FONT></st1:City></st1:place><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"> - The
pumps are the size of school buses.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Delta
smelt match up with your goldfish.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The pumps
are worth $300 billion for the economy.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The smelt
aren't worth the bait in a fisherman's tackle box.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The pumps
water crops for your garden salad.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The smelt
simply smell like cucumber.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Last week,
a judge ruled that immense pumps near <st1:City w:st="on">Tracy</st1:City> must
be shut down unless officials get a permit allowing them to kill smelt and other
fish in the process of sending water to distant reaches of <st1:State
w:st="on"><st1:place
w:st="on">California</st1:place></st1:State>.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The case
puts the smelt back in the headlines. It is in danger of extinction,
conservationists say, and no fewer than 45 studies are chronicling the
problem.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">And yet,
when you ask your neighbor about the Delta smelt, he might wrinkle his nose and
say something like, "Yeah, it DOES smell out
there."<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Why should
ordinary people care, or even know, about this rather ordinary
fish?<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<H2 style="MARGIN: 0pt"><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">Sign of trouble<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></H2>
<H2 style="MARGIN: 0pt"><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=#043d63
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: normal;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: #043d63"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></H2>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The first
thing most experts say is that the smelt is an "indicator" species. It tells us
how the Delta is doing.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">If the
smelt is suffering, so may be a number of other species which have more purpose
to humans - striped bass, for example, a popular sport
fish.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Among
other things, the smelt suffers from a declining supply of its major food
source, plankton. Exotic clams introduced into the estuary two decades ago have
robbed the water of much of these nutrients.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Then there
are toxins: anything from herbicides that drain off of farmers' fields to drugs
that people pour down their drains at home. These kill the food that smelt and
other fish need.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Keep in
mind, this is the same water that wets the taps of 23 million Californians.
<st1:place w:st="on"><st1:City w:st="on">Stockton</st1:City></st1:place>, too,
plans to quench its thirst with Delta water in coming
years.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<H2 style="MARGIN: 0pt"><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">Endangered<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></H2>
<H2 style="MARGIN: 0pt"><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=#043d63
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: normal;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: #043d63"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></H2>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The smelt
is legally protected from these dangers by a law that has aided more glamorous
specimens such as the bald eagle.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"We made a
decision with the Endangered Species Act, saying we didn't want any species to
go extinct, at least on our watch," said Peter Moyle, professor of fish biology
at the <st1:PlaceType w:st="on">University</st1:PlaceType> of <st1:PlaceName
w:st="on">California</st1:PlaceName>, <st1:place w:st="on"><st1:City
w:st="on">Davis</st1:City></st1:place>. "It becomes a question of where do you
draw the line in terms of what you're going to let go and what you're
not."<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">There are
about 35,000 smelt left, according to some estimates, compared to 800,000 in the
1960s and '70s.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">If the
smelt disappears, a fish called the split-tail could be next, Moyle said. Unlike
smelt, the split-tail is a dietary staple for Asian-Americans, including many in
<st1:place w:st="on"><st1:City
w:st="on">Stockton</st1:City></st1:place>.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">On the
other hand, if the smelt is recovered, maybe it could produce a commercial
fishery someday not unlike its Japanese cousin, the
wakasagi.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"You never
know what's going to be important to future generations," Moyle
said.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<H2 style="MARGIN: 0pt"><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">Money, money, money<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></H2>
<H2 style="MARGIN: 0pt"><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=#043d63
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: normal;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: #043d63"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></H2>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">A recent
California Department of Water Resources report updating the smelt's status
catalogues dozens of strategies to bring back the
fish.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Most
projects rely on public dollars; the total cost is
unknown.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">As an
example, experts want to construct mile-long floodways on <st1:place
w:st="on"><st1:PlaceName w:st="on">Sherman</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Type
w:st="on">Island</st1:PlaceType></st1:place> to increase production of the
plankton that smelt need. The cost could range from $5.5 million to $8.2
million.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">There also
is talk of requiring the state to check all watercraft that enter <st1:place
w:st="on"><st1:State w:st="on">California</st1:State></st1:place> through major
highways, a practice that was discontinued in 2003 because of budget cuts. This
could detect the presence of invasive mussels which, if released, could further
exacerbate problems in the Delta.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">The cost:
Up to $4 million per year, and perhaps a headache for those whose boats are
inspected.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<H2 style="MARGIN: 0pt"><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">The pumps<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></H2>
<H2 style="MARGIN: 0pt"><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=#043d63
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: normal;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: #043d63"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></H2>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Theoretically,
anyone who gets water from the pumps could benefit if the smelt recovers. It's
not just <st1:City w:st="on">Los Angeles</st1:City> - parts of the Bay Area,
much of <st1:place w:st="on"><st1:PlaceName w:st="on">San
Joaquin</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Type
w:st="on">County</st1:PlaceType></st1:place> and the coast may not have to worry
so much about the pumps shutting down.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Conversely,
if smelt continue to struggle, farmers might face new restrictions on pesticide
use, possibly making land less productive and losing income, state reports warn.
Cities might pay more to reduce the number of contaminants they
discharge.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Debate
continues over the pumps themselves and how many fish they chop
up.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<H2 style="MARGIN: 0pt"><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">Unknowns<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></H2>
<H2 style="MARGIN: 0pt"><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" color=#043d63
size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-WEIGHT: normal; F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: #043d63"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></H2>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">In the
late 1990s, scientists discovered that the common western fence lizard may help
prevent the spread of Lyme disease.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">Infected
ticks that feed on the lizard's blood are then less likely to infect
humans.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">This,
conservationists say, is an example why the smelt and other less-interesting
critters should be spared extinction.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">They may
yet serve a purpose.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">"There's a
lot we don't know," said Jeff Miller of the San Francisco-based Center for
Biological Diversity, which has lobbied the government for greater smelt
protections. "To lose a species before you even understand it is
tragic."<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'"><o:p> </o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<H2 style="MARGIN: 0pt"><B><FONT face="Times New Roman" size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t">Why should you care about
smelt?<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></B></H2>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">1. The
fish is an “indicator” species. Their situation offers insight into how the San
Joaquin Delta as a whole is faring.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">2. As an
endangered species, the smelt’s future is important to others creatures in the
same boat. If the smelt don’t make it, what’s next?<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">3.
Proposals to save the fish can carry with them million-dollar price tags that
would likely require public funding. <o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">4.
Recovery of the smelt could provide benefits to anyone who gets water from the
pumps in <st1:City w:st="on"><st1:place w:st="on">Tracy</st1:place></st1:City>.
Conversely, its continued struggle could carry negative effects for <st1:place
w:st="on"><st1:PlaceName w:st="on">S.J.</st1:PlaceName> <st1:PlaceType
w:st="on">County</st1:PlaceType></st1:place>
farmers.<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
<P class=articlegraf style="MARGIN: 0pt; LINE-HEIGHT: normal"><FONT
face="Times New Roman" color=black size=4><SPAN
style="FONT-SIZE: 14pt; COLOR: black;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man'">5. Besides
known benefits, creatures can be beneficial in many yet-undiscovered ways. If
the animal disappears, any benefits it <BR>might have held will be lost forever.
#<o:p></o:p></SPAN></FONT></P>
